Delve into the world of tabletop experiments in this comprehensive lecture by Marianna Safronova. Explore cutting-edge techniques and methodologies used in small-scale scientific investigations. Gain insights into the design, setup, and execution of experiments that can be conducted on a laboratory bench. Learn about the advantages and challenges of tabletop experiments, their applications in various scientific fields, and how they contribute to advancing our understanding of fundamental physical principles. Discover the latest developments in precision measurements, atomic and molecular physics, and quantum optics through real-world examples and case studies presented by the expert. Enhance your knowledge of experimental physics and acquire valuable skills for conducting your own tabletop experiments in this engaging 1 hour and 45 minute lecture from the Galileo Galilei Institute.
